Position Overview Performs advanced, diversified and confidential administrative duties requiring broad and comprehensive experience, skill and knowledge of organization policies and practices for a member of the Executive Leadership Team. Prepares correspondence, memoranda, reports, etc. Initiates routine and non routine correspondence and memoranda. Screens telephone calls and visitors, and resolves routine and complex inquiries. Schedules appointments, meetings and travel itineraries, and coordinates related arrangements. Prepares and distributes minutes of meetings. May utilize the assistance of one or more support staff members on a reporting or project basis. Operates a personal computer and appropriate software packages or its equivalent. Reports to the a member of our Executive Leadership Team.

Requirements

  • High school diploma/GED required
  • Five to seven (5-7) years of executive administrative assistant experience required
  • Experience and skill with Microsoft© Office application (Word, Outlook, PowerPoint, and Excel) required
  • Personal time management and organizational skills
  • Verbal and written communication skills
  • Dependable and adaptable to operate within a fast-paced work environment
  • Ability to manage highly confidential information
